The Capital University women's tennis team visited its cross-town rival Saturday and was defeated 9-0 against Otterbein in an Ohio Athletic Conference dual match at Clements Recreation Center in Westerville.
The Crusaders fell to 0-5 overall and 0-2 in the OAC, while the Cardinals improved to 10-2 overall and 1-0 in the league.
Junior Alyssa Trier (Venetia, Pa.) and sophomore Ashlin Gable (Bluffton, Ohio) took one game at No. 1 doubles. Gable also took two games in the first set of her singles match at the No. 2 slot.
Junior Corinne Hohenstein (Sidney, Ohio) picked up two games in the second set at the third singles position, while sophomore Jennie Schott (Pickerington, Ohio) took a game in the first set at No. 4.
Sophomore Kelsey Niese (Shelby, Ohio) took one game each in the first and second sets at No. 6 singles.
Capital resumes conference play Wednesday against Muskingum. First serve is slated for 3:30 p.m. at the Capital Tennis Courts.
